Paul George Boldly Says Lakers And Kings Will Be Challenges For The Clippers Next Season

Paul George mentions Lakers and Kings as big challenges for the Lakers next campaign.

The Los Angeles Clippers are one of the favorite teams to win it all this upcoming season following three years of falling short to win the championship. Last season, they missed Kawhi Leonard, and Paul George was also absent for a big chunk of the campaign. Well, now they are healthy and ready to go in a stacked Western Conference. 

They have a lot to prove after all the good moves they’ve been making in recent years, and George is well aware of that. Recently, PG13 said that he’s locked in to win a championship, explaining that he understands the assignment and won’t rest until the job is done. 

“Winning it all. Being the last team standing and becoming a champion. That window is shrinking and not a lot of teams can say before a season starts that they have a chance to win it. And I don’t want to miss out on that chance.”

He’s ready to win it all, but the journey won’t be easy for the Clippers. They’ll have to go through a very difficult conference to make it to the Finals. 


Paul George Says Which Teams Will Be Difficult To Face This Season

George and co. are well aware of how teams like the Denver Nuggets, Phoenix Suns, Memphis Grizzlies, and Dallas Mavericks are expected to compete for the top spot in the West, but he also mentioned other teams that will be a tough challenge for the Clips. 

Starting with the defending NBA champions Golden State Warriors, George made his statement about the challenges his team will face. However, he also mentioned two teams that aren’t considered contenders by anybody, but PG13 is keeping an eye on them just in case. 

“Obviously, the Warriors, No. 1. The best in the league, rightfully so, defending champions,” George said during the Clippers media day, via NBC Sports. “The Lakers are the Lakers, they’re going to be a challenge.

“[Sacramento] is a young up-and-coming team that can give you a rough night.”

After two seasons very different from each other, the Clippers are now keen to return to the top of the West and improve what they did in 2021, where they played in the Western Conference Finals for the first time in franchise history. There are at least 5 teams that can give the Clippers a run for their money, but none of them are the Lakers or Kings. 

It’s good to see that he’s paying attention to everybody and isn’t underestimating any team, but nobody is losing sleep over the Lakers or Kings at this very moment.
